Steel beam web penetrations are restricted to the middle third of the beam depth and must maintain a minimum distance of two times the beam depth from supports, edges of other openings, or concentrated loads from intersecting beams or columns above. Individual penetrations are limited to a maximum diameter of six inches typical and must be located within the middle third of the beam span. Spacing between adjacent openings and clear distances to intersecting members are governed by dimensional limits relative to beam depth D.
